Subject: [PATCH 05/13] mtd: spinand: Add adjust_op() in manufacturer_ops to modify the ops for manufacturer specific changes

Manufacturers might use a variation of standard SPI NAND flash
instructions, e.g. Winbond W35N01JW changes the dummy cycle length for
read register commands when in Octal DTR mode.

Add new function in manufacturer_ops: adjust_op(), which can be called
to correct the spi_mem op for any alteration in the instruction made by
the manufacturers. And hence, this function can also be used for
incorporating variations of SPI instructions in Octal DTR mode.
